If you are taking part, you can register for your race using the QR code on the poster, you will be able to register on the day, but pre-booking will speed up the process and enable you to collect your wristband on arrival.

To win any of the races you must be in a team of two, larger teams and chariots will be assessed for creativity and fancy dress. Our judges, Rev. Janice Collier, Spajers president Don Rouse and TV presenter Henry Cole will assess all entrants in a line up from the Morris Clown to the Market Square between 5.00 and 5.30pm. Be on time with your wristbands to make sure your creations are judged.

Funding the event

The Bampton Shirt Race is funded entirely by donations. In recent years costs have increased considerably reducing the amount raised to support our elderly citizens and threatening the viability of continuing the event. Feedback from the 2025 race proposed a small charge for entry. This is not something we would consider as the race is open to everyone. We are suggesting that senior teams provide a minimum donation of £5 per person to support the event and help in ensuring its survival.

We are extremely fortunate to have secured sponsorship for this year’s event from Rosebank Care Home and in future years hope to drive more funding in sponsorship of the individual races. Please let us know if you would be interested.
